*{box-sizing:border-box}html,body{font-family:'Rubik',sans-serif;font-size:10px;line-height:1.2;font-style:normal;font-weight:400;color:#2a2c2b;padding:0;margin:0}h1,h2,h3,h4,h5,h6{font-family:'Roboto Slab',serif;font-size:4.5rem;font-weight:400;padding:0;margin:0}header,main,footer{display:block;width:100%;min-width:320px;max-width:1920px;font-size:1.8rem;margin:0 auto}header{position:fixed;top:0;z-index:1000;background-color:#fff}.wrapper{display:block;width:100%;max-width:1170px;margin:0 auto}.toggle{display:none}.nav ul{display:flex;justify-content:center;align-items:center;list-style:none;padding:0;margin:0}.nav li{display:inline-block;margin-right:30px}.nav li:last-child{margin-right:0}.nav a,.nav a:hover,.nav a:active,.nav a:visited{display:block;font-family:'Rubik',sans-serif;font-size:1.8rem;line-height:1.2;font-style:normal;font-weight:400;color:#2a2c2b;border-bottom:1px solid rgba(9,180,98,0);padding:30px 0 27px 0;text-decoration:none;text-transform:uppercase;transition:all 0.2s ease}.nav a:hover{color:#09b462;border-bottom:1px solid #09b462}.header{height:82px}.first-screen{background-image:url(../img/bulb.png);background-repeat:no-repeat;background-position:0 0}.first-screen__box,.for-whom__box,footer .wrapper{display:flex;justify-content:space-between;align-items:center}.first-screen__content,.first-screen__img,.for-whom__content,.for-whom__img{width:50%}.first-screen__content h1{display:block;width:100%;max-width:370px}.first-screen__content h1 span{display:inline-block;line-height:1;color:#fff;background-color:#2a2c2b;border-radius:10px;padding:0 5px 1px 5px}.first-screen__content p,.for-whom__content p{line-height:1.4;padding:0;margin:0;margin-top:35px}.first-screen__content a,.first-screen__content a:hover,.first-screen__content a:active,.first-screen__content a:visited,.about-book a,.about-book a:hover,.about-book a:active,.about-book a:visited{display:inline-block;font-family:'Rubik',sans-serif;font-size:1.4rem;line-height:1.2;font-style:normal;font-weight:700;color:#fff;background-color:#09b462;border-radius:10px;padding:17px 75px 15px 75px;text-decoration:none;text-transform:uppercase;margin-top:35px}.first-screen__img img{width:100%;height:auto}.about-book{background-image:url(../img/bg1.svg);background-repeat:no-repeat;background-position:top center;background-size:auto 100%;padding:170px 0}.about-book p,.about-author p{display:block;max-width:870px;line-height:1.4;padding:0;margin:0;margin-top:30px}.for-whom{padding-top:65px}.for-whom__img img{width:80%;height:auto}.for-whom__content ul{list-style-image:url(../img/check-mark.png);padding:0;margin:0;margin-top:40px}.for-whom__content li{position:relative;margin-left:28px}.for-whom__content li p{padding:0;margin:0;margin-top:20px}.about-author{min-height:757px;background-image:url(../img/bg2.png);background-repeat:no-repeat;background-position:top center;background-size:auto 100%;padding:185px 0 155px 0;margin-top:80px}.about-author__content{max-width:670px}.section-form{margin-top:35px;text-align:center}.section-form h2{display:block;max-width:570px;margin:0 auto}.section-form p{display:block;max-width:660px;line-height:1.4;margin:0 auto;margin-top:40px;text-align:center}.section-form form{margin-top:45px}.section-form input{display:block;width:100%;max-width:570px;font-size:1.4rem;font-family:'Rubik',sans-serif;color:#8B758B;border-radius:10px;border:1px solid #bdc3c7;padding:16px 30px 15px 30px;margin:0 auto;margin-top:12px;outline:none}.section-form textarea{display:block;width:100%;max-width:570px;font-family:'Rubik',sans-serif;font-size:1.4rem;line-height:1.2;font-style:normal;font-weight:400;color:#2a2c2b;color:#8B758B;border-radius:10px;border:1px solid #bdc3c7;padding:16px 30px 15px 30px;margin:0 auto;margin-top:12px;outline:none;resize:none}.section-form input[type="submit"]{font-size:1.4rem;font-weight:700;color:#fff;background-color:#09b462;border:1px solid #09b462;text-transform:uppercase;cursor:pointer}footer{background-color:#09b462;margin-top:100px}footer .wrapper{min-height:100px}footer p{font-size:1.4rem;color:#fff}footer ul{display:flex;justify-content:space-between;align-items:center;list-style:none;padding:0;margin:0}footer li{margin-right:25px}footer li:last-child{margin-right:0}footer a,footer a:hover,footer a:active,footer a:visited{font-family:'Rubik',sans-serif;font-size:1.4rem;line-height:1.2;font-style:normal;font-weight:400;color:#fff;text-decoration:none}footer a:hover{text-decoration:underline}@media only screen and (max-width:1330px){.first-screen{background:none}}@media only screen and (max-width:1190px){.wrapper{padding:0 10px}}@media only screen and (max-width:991px){.header{height:40px}.toggle{position:relative;z-index:100;display:block;width:20px;height:20px;margin-top:10px;margin-bottom:10px}.toggle span{position:absolute;top:calc(50% - 1px);display:block;width:100%;height:2px;background-color:#2a2c2b;border-radius:10px}.toggle span::before{content:"";position:absolute;top:calc(50% - 1px);display:block;width:100%;height:2px;background-color:#2a2c2b;border-radius:10px;transform:translateY(-6px);transition:all 0.2s ease}.toggle span::after{content:"";position:absolute;top:calc(50% - 1px);display:block;width:100%;height:2px;background-color:#2a2c2b;border-radius:10px;transform:translateY(6px);transition:all 0.2s ease}.toggle_active{position:fixed;z-index:100000}.toggle_active span{height:0}.toggle_active span::before{transform:rotate(45deg)}.toggle_active span::after{transform:rotate(-45deg)}.nav{position:fixed;top:0;right:0;z-index:10000;display:block;width:100%;height:100vh;background-color:rgba(255,255,255,1);padding:40px 0 0 0;opacity:1;transform:translateY(0)}.nav ul{width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:flex-start}.nav ul li{display:block;width:100%;margin-right:0}.nav ul a,.nav ul a:hover,.nav ul a:active,.nav ul a:visited{text-align:center;padding:15px 15px;border-bottom:none}.nav a:hover{color:#2a2c2b;border:none}.nav_closed{transform:translateY(-100vh);opacity:0}h1,h2{font-size:2rem;font-weight:700}p{font-size:1.4rem}.first-screen__content a,.first-screen__content a:hover,.first-screen__content a:active,.first-screen__content a:visited{font-size:1.2rem;line-height:1.2;padding:17px 50px 15px 50px;margin-top:20px}.about-book{margin-top:-90px}.for-whom{padding-top:0}.for-whom__content li{margin-left:40px}.for-whom__content li::before{position:absolute;top:8px;left:-40px;width:30px;height:26px;background-size:100% auto}.about-author{position:relative;min-height:0;background:none;background-color:#f2fbf7;padding:150px 0 10px 0}.about-author::before{position:absolute;top:-60px;left:calc(50% - 100px);display:block;width:200px;height:200px;content:"";background-color:#f2fbf7;background-image:url(../img/autor.png);border-radius:50%}.about-author__content{max-width:100%;background-color:#fff;border-radius:10px;padding:20px}footer{padding-bottom:10px;margin-top:40px}footer .wrapper{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center}.footer__nav li{margin-right:0}.footer__nav{display:flex;flex-direction:column;justify-content:center;align-items:center;order:1;margin:20px 0 20px 0}.footer_copy{order:3}.footer_nerwork{order:2	}}@media only screen and (max-width:575px){header,main,footer{text-align:center}.first-screen__box,.for-whom__box,.section-form form,footer .wrapper{display:flex;flex-direction:column;justify-content:space-between;align-items:center}.first-screen__content,.first-screen__img,.for-whom__content,.for-whom__img{width:100%}.first-screen__content{order:2}.first-screen__img{order:1}.first-screen__content a,.first-screen__content a:hover,.first-screen__content a:active,.first-screen__content a:visited,.about-book a,.about-book a:hover,.about-book a:active,.about-book a:visited{font-size:1.2rem}.section-form input[type="submit"]{font-size:1.2rem}